Downloading Mono Font Installer v2.1 APK

Okay, so you're convinced that you need this font magic in your life. The next step? Downloading the Mono Font Installer v2.1 APK. This is where things can get a little tricky, so pay close attention. Unlike apps from the Google Play Store, APK files need to be downloaded from other sources. This means you have to be extra careful to ensure you're getting a safe, legitimate file. Here’s the lowdown on how to do it right.

First and foremost, always download APK files from trusted sources. This cannot be stressed enough. There are many websites out there offering APK downloads, but not all of them have your best interests at heart. Some might host modified versions of the APK that contain malware or other nasty surprises. Stick to well-known and reputable websites or forums that have a history of providing safe downloads. A good rule of thumb is to check user reviews and ratings for the website or the specific download. If there are a lot of negative comments or warnings, steer clear.

Some of the places you might find the Mono Font Installer v2.1 APK include popular Android developer forums, tech blogs that offer downloads, or websites that specialize in APK files. Do a little research and see what sources are recommended by other users. Once you've found a trustworthy source, make sure the file you're downloading is actually the correct version (v2.1) and that it hasn't been tampered with. Look for checksums or MD5 hashes, which are like digital fingerprints for files. You can use these to verify that the downloaded file matches the original.

Before you hit that download button, there’s one more thing you need to do. Android, by default, blocks the installation of apps from unknown sources. This is a security measure to protect you from malicious apps. To install the Mono Font Installer, you’ll need to temporarily enable installations from unknown sources. Don't worry, it’s not as scary as it sounds. Just go to your phone's settings, then Security (or Privacy, depending on your device), and look for the “Install unknown apps” option. Toggle the switch to allow installations from your web browser or file manager (whichever you'll be using to install the APK). Remember to turn this setting off again after you’ve installed the font installer to keep your device secure.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Okay, so you've downloaded, installed, and started using the Mono Font Installer v2.1 APK. But what happens if things don't go quite as planned? Sometimes, tech hiccups occur, but don't panic! Most issues can be resolved with a little troubleshooting. Let's look at some common problems you might encounter and how to fix them. Being prepared for potential issues can save you a lot of frustration and keep your font customization journey smooth and enjoyable.

One of the most common issues is the installation failing. If you try to install the APK and it just doesn't work, the first thing to check is whether you've enabled installations from unknown sources in your settings. This is a crucial step, and if you've missed it, the installation will definitely fail. Go back to your settings, find the “Install unknown apps” option (usually under Security or Privacy), and make sure it's toggled on for your browser or file manager.

Another reason for installation failures could be a corrupted APK file. If the file didn't download properly or got damaged during the download process, it might not install correctly. Try downloading the APK again from a reliable source. Before you do, it’s a good idea to clear your browser's cache and cookies, as this can sometimes interfere with downloads. Also, ensure you have a stable internet connection while downloading to prevent interruptions.

Sometimes, even if the installation is successful, the Mono Font Installer might not work as expected. For example, it might not detect any fonts on your device, or it might fail to apply the font system-wide. In this case, make sure the font files are in a format that the app supports (usually .ttf or .otf). Also, try placing the font files in a dedicated folder, such as a “Fonts” folder in your device's internal storage. This can help the app locate them more easily.

If you've applied a font and it's causing readability issues or other problems, you can always revert back to your default font. The Mono Font Installer should have an option to restore your device's original font settings. If you can't find this option, you can usually change the font manually in your device's display settings. Go to Settings > Display > Font (or something similar, depending on your device) and select your default font.
